You only set it according the number of cells in series. Parallel doesn’t matter to the meter. It only reads voltage and divides it by the number of cells in series.
Hi namasaki when I set the battery indicator to 8s it shows only 30%charged but the voltmeter shows 28volts thats more like 98%charged
8s liion fully charged should be 33.6 volts. Unless you’re using lifepo4
